One night after enduring a shutout, the Cubs unleashed a remarkable 14 runs and accumulated 15 hits within the final three innings, culminating in a commanding 16-0 victory. This win not only marked the Dodgers&#8217; first home loss of the season but also constitutes their worst home shutout defeat in franchise history. The Cubs amassed 21 hits, including nine that were extra base hits, showcasing their offensive strength.
